Understanding Sodium Hypochlorite: What Is It?
Sodium hypochlorite is a chemical compound typically discovered in home bleach. Its effective oxidizing residential or commercial properties make it a reliable agent for cleaning and disinfecting surfaces. This compound works by breaking down organic matter, that includes mold and mildew, eventually removing them from the surfaces on which they thrive.
How Does Sodium Hypochlorite Work?
When sodium hypochlorite enters contact with mold spores, it reacts chemically to interrupt their cellular structure. This procedure leads to the deterioration of the mold, efficiently eliminating it off. The adaptability of sodium hypochlorite means it can be utilized on numerous surfaces, making it a go-to solution for house owners facing mold problems.

The Significance of Appropriate Dilution
Using sodium hypochlorite efficiently needs understanding about dilution ratios. A typical suggestion for mold removal is a mixture of one part sodium hypochlorite to 10 parts water. This diluted service supplies a sufficient concentration to deal with most molds without harmful surfaces.

If you're considering taking on mold removal yourself using sodium hypochlorite, here's a basic recipe:
Ingredients:
- 1 part sodium hypochlorite 10 parts water 1 cup of surfactant (like dish soap)
Instructions:
Mix all active ingredients thoroughly. Use a spray wand on your pressure washer or garden sprayer to apply the service equally throughout impacted areas. Allow it time to sit (about 15 minutes) before rinsing off with water.This basic yet efficient approach is perfect for those wanting to maintain their property without large service fees.
Safety Considerations When Utilizing Sodium Hypochlorite
Even though sodium hypochlorite is effective for mold elimination, security ought to constantly precede when managing chemicals.
Protective Measures
- Always use gloves and eye security when working with sodium hypochlorite. Ensure proper ventilation if utilized inside to avoid inhalation of fumes. Keep children and animals far from treated locations until completely dried and safe.
Storage Guidelines
Store any remaining diluted options in a cool, dark location far from direct sunlight as direct exposure can degrade their effectiveness over time.
Frequently Asked Questions About Sodium Hypochlorite and Mold Removal
Q1: Can I utilize routine bleach rather of salt hypochlorite?
A1: Regular family bleach is mainly made up of sodium hypochlorite; nevertheless, specialized formulas created for cleaning may be more reliable due to added surfactants or stabilizers.
Q2: How long does it take for sodium hypochlorite to kill mold?
A2: Normally, you must allow the option to sit on the surface for at least 10-- 15 minutes before rinsing it off for optimum results.
Q3: Is it safe to use around plants?
A3: Sodium hypochlorite can hurt plants if not applied thoroughly; it's finest to cover surrounding plants or use during cooler parts of the day when plants are less stressed.
Q4: Can I mix other cleaners with salt hypochlorite?
A4: No! Mixing sodium hypochlorite with ammonia or acidic cleaners produces harmful gases that threaten when inhaled.
Q5: Will using sodium hypochlorite impact my paint or siding?
A5: While diluted options are usually safe for a lot of painted surfaces and siding products, it's recommended to test on a little location initially before full application.
Q6: How typically must I perform upkeep cleaning using this method?
A6: Depending upon your local environment's humidity levels and direct exposure conditions, performing maintenance cleansings every 6-- 12 months can help prevent considerable accumulation of mildew and mold.
